Recently, the increased adoption of electric vehicles (EVs) has significantly demanded new energy storage systems (ESS) technologies. In this way, Lithium-ion batteries (LIB) are mainstream technology for application. Lithium presents several advantages compared with other chemicals because it can provide delivery a long time, lifetime, and high density capacity. The LIB comprises cells connected in different configurations, such as parallel, series, or combinations. This variety designs makes monitoring control process more complex, complicating diagnosing prognosis abuses failures. Battery Storage for Supplementing Renewable Energy Systems

Battery energy storage can be integrated with renewable energy generation systems in either grid-connected or standalone applications. For stand-alone systems, batteries are essential to store electricity for use when the sun is not shining or when the wind is not blowing.
